Consists Of Pre-Installed On/Off Change (25505)”/ > If you’re searching for a recreational vehicle level that does not require using screws or adhesive to attach it to your home, look no more than the Camco Easy Level. This best RV level can be saved away throughout your home. To use, simply take it out of the cabinet or basement and location it in the middle of your floor. Make certain the legs are dealing with front-to-back and side-to-side. Turn it on and enjoy it light up. When all the lights turn green, you are level and prepared to begin enjoying your vacation. As you can imagine, this is easiest to utilize with a motorhome where you can see the lights from your rearview mirror while you make changes. However, the Camco system can still be used with a towable unit. Merely have your travel partner set up inside your home with the Easy Level and interact via cell phone.
The Camco Easy Level does not have an on-off switch. It does have an automated shut-off, which extends the battery life. However, the unit can think it’s time to turn on at times when it isn’t. This does not assist the battery life when it switches on while you’re taking a trip down the roadway.
To be on the safe side, you might wish to get rid of the batteries when you’re not using it. Whatever you decide to do, it’s always a safe option to keep extra batteries on hand.
If the thumbs-ups are too dim for you, just watch for the red lights to switch off when leveling your RV.

RV Level Buyer’s Guide
When thinking about which is the best RV level for your vacation home, you might have a couple of more concerns about what to try to find. Here are some of the most crucial functions to think about.
Toughness
With the exception of the Camco Easy Level, all of the RV levels evaluated install outdoors your RV. Having a level that is resilient along with functional is a must.
One way to keep your RV level durable is to make sure that it does not flop around in the wind while you’re driving. You can utilize screws, or JB Weld, if you do not want to make holes in your RV.
Precision
To ensure that your level is precise, set up your recreational vehicle in your driveway like you would an outdoor camping spot. Then, get a carpenter’s level to confirm and fine-tune your RV level if necessary.
Doing this in the house before removing will make setting up much easier at your destination.
Easy to Check out
Choosing a RV level that is easy to read is extremely important! However, positioning your level, particularly a bubble level, where it is easy to see, is simply as crucial. Keep both these factors in mind when acquiring and positioning your recreational vehicle level.
Finest Recreational Vehicle Level Frequently Asked Concerns
Does my recreational vehicle have to be perfectly level?
Really, no, though you do want to get it as close to level as possible. For safety’s sake, you should disappear than 1-2 degrees off level or about half a bubble for a bubble level.
Why is it crucial to level my RV?
Having a RV that isn’t level can throw off your balance when strolling through and harm your home appliances.
In addition, a RV that isn’t level can shake off your water and sewage drainage. No one wishes to deal with that possible disaster!
Exist any pointers for utilizing a RV level?
The very best tip for using a recreational vehicle level is to set it up while you’re at home first. That way, you can confirm your level and exercise any bugs before removing.
